President Michael D Higgins has opened a new facility in Naas today, aimed at providing housing for those affected by homelessness.

Homeless figures nationally have risen 23% in the past year to a total of almost 10,000 people and of those,1,230 were aged between 18 and 24.
The President says the housing policy here is a 'disaster'.

Michael D Higgins was speaking as he opened a centre for homeless young adults in County Kildare this afternoon.

The facility in Naas will be run by Tiglin and accommodate seven men and five women between the ages of 18 and 25.
